SPRINGFIELD, Mass. -- October 9, 2007 -- Paced behind a pair of goals from Caitlin Sawczuk (Plainville, Conn.), the No. 25 Springfield College women’s soccer team rolled past MIT, 6-0, on Brock-Affleck Field at the Irv Schmid Sports Complex on Tuesday evening in New England Women's and Men's Athletic Conference action. With the win, the Pride improves to 11-2, 4-1 in conference play while the Engineers drop to 8-4, 3-2.
Springfield, who is ranked 25th in the latest D3kicks.com poll, outshot the Engineers 25-4 in the game and have now outscored its opponents 39-1 this season at home.
Springfield wasted no time tallying the first goal of the game as Jillian Pereira (East Providence, R.I.) ripped a shot from 25 yards out into the top of the net past the outstretched arms of MIT goalie Stephanie Brenman just 1:42 into the match. Lauren Peltier (Agawam, Mass.) then tallied the Pride’s second goal of the game after she finished up a rebound from six yards out at the 21:19 mark. Sawczuk then recorded her first goal of the match 36 seconds later to conclude Springfield’s scoring in the first half.
Sawczuk opened up the second half scoring with a tally just 3:24 into the stanza to give Springfield a 4-0 lead. Nicole Hanewich (Smithfield, R.I.) netted her team-leading 13th goal of the season at the 55:25 mark before Suzanne Silva (Ludlow, Mass.) wrapped up the scoring for the Pride 3:15 later.
Sue Jenney (Agawam, Mass.) and Katie Delude (Chicopee, Mass.) combined for the shutout on the evening.
The Pride returns to action on Saturday when it travels to take on conference-foe Smith . Kick-off is slated for 1:00 p.m.
